Switchboard upgrades are turning into one of the most asked for electrical services for house owners and business operators across Sydney, NSW, as ageing electrical infrastructure struggles to keep pace with modern power needs. Lots of homes throughout the city, particularly older homes constructed decades earlier, still rely on outdated fuse boxes that were never ever created to manage the load of modern appliances, air conditioning systems, electrical lorry chargers and smart home systems. When a switchboard is overwhelmed or weakening, it can trip constantly, overheat, or in worse cases, end up being a major fire risk. This is why switchboard upgrades have become such a priority for homeowner who want to protect their families, tenants, and staff members while also ensuring their electrical system satisfies existing safety requirements. A licensed electrician can examine the condition of an existing switchboard and suggest the right upgrade course, whether that indicates changing old ceramic fuses with modern-day breaker, installing safety switches, or completely upgrading the whole distribution board to accommodate higher capacity loads.

One of the biggest benefits of switchboard upgrades is the improved safety they supply. Older switchboards frequently do not have residual existing gadgets, typically called safety switches, which are designed to cut power quickly if a fault is found, safeguarding people from electric shock. Without this defense, a faulty home appliance or harmed circuitry could lead to a harmful situation, consisting of electrocution or an electrical fire. Switchboard upgrades typically include fitting these vital security gadgets, in addition to rise security to secure sensitive electronics versus voltage spikes triggered by storms or grid variations. For households with kids, senior locals, or anybody utilizing power tools and devices daily, this included layer of defense provides real peace of mind. Insurance companies are likewise significantly asking whether a property has an upgraded switchboard, and in some circumstances, a non-compliant board could impact a claim following an electrical incident, making switchboard upgrades not simply a safety factor to consider but a financial one too.

Switchboard upgrades surpass mere safety; they are essential for meeting the increasing power needs of today's homes and companies. As more Sydney homeowner add solar arrays, battery storage, ducted HVAC systems, and electric‑vehicle chargers, the load on an existing switchboard can increase considerably. An old panel simply isn't constructed to manage that additional demand, frequently triggering repeated circuit journeys or, in the worst case, an overall system shutdown at the most bothersome time. Replacing the switchboard provides the necessary capacity and proper circuit design to accommodate these new devices safely and effectively. This is particularly essential for anyone undertaking a remodel, an extension, or installing new appliances, since constructing certifiers and electricians regularly identify an undersized switchboard as a required fix before any further work can continue. Updating at the proper moment can for that reason avoid significant disturbances and pricey repair work later on, preventing the requirement for emergency service calls.

Price is undoubtedly an aspect for anybody contemplating a switchboard upgrade, and the expense can vary get more info based on the home's size, the intricacy of the current circuitry, and the level of the work needed. An easy upgrade that includes new security switches and circuit breakers will normally be cheaper than a total switchboard replacement that incorporates extra circuits, a bigger enclosure, or three‑phase power for a commercial setting. It's suggested to obtain an extensive quote from a certified, insured electrician who can examine the properties on website rather than depending on an unclear phone quote. A trustworthy tradesperson will information exactly what the upgrade involves, the expected duration of the job, and any required council approvals or evaluations. Although switchboard upgrades include a preliminary outlay, the long‑term benefits-- boosted safety, higher dependability, and a lower possibility of pricey electrical damage-- make the expense beneficial for many homeowner.
